They look nice.

I'm not sure what the intended use for them is so I'm being cautions in pointing out the aliased text.

Did you apply any smoothing to the text? or if you used the text as a selection mask to erase the image below did you have anti-aliased checked off?

Then again this all might not make sense if you're not using photoshop, or other program with these options.

It appears that you have enough colors in the PNG format to produce a nice anti-aliased edge, the original sphere is proof of that, I'm only wondering why you didn't do the same for the text.

Then again if these pictures are to be reduced in size then the aliased edges would help make the letter more clear, but the resize would have to be done under RGB to allow for some natural softening of the edges by blending the colors and then converted back to PNG indexed format for use if thats the final format.
